Embodiment 1

[0026] Step 1: Prepare 200ml each of a gelatin aqueous solution with a mass concentration of 3% and a gum arabic solution with a mass concentration of 3%, and mix the two solutions.

[0027] Step 2: Add 4g of mugwort oil to the mixed solution obtained in the first step, stir for 25min at a stirring speed of 300r / min and a temperature of 40°C, mix and disperse mugwort oil in the above mixed solution to obtain an emulsion .

[0028] The third step: add 100 ml of deionized water to the emulsion obtained in the second step, and stir for 20 minutes at a stirring speed of 300 r / min to obtain a dilution.

[0029] The fourth step: adjust the pH value of the diluent obtained in the third step to 3.8 to obtain the prepolymerization solution.

[0030] The fifth step: Under the condition of a stirring speed of 300r / min, the temperature of the prepolymerized liquid obtained in the fourth step is naturally reduced to 2°C, and the temperature is kept for 40 minutes to obtain the agglomerated liquid....

Abstract

The invention relates to a preparation method of antibacterial Chinese mugwort oil microcapsules, which comprises the steps of using gelatine as a wall material to emulsify Chinese mugwort, adding water to dilute, adjusting potential of hydrogen (pH) to be below an isoelectric point of the gelatine to be adsorbed with Arabic gum of negative charges, forming microcapsule rudiment, then performing low temperature jelly, adding a cross-linking agent in a coagulation microcapsule, performing chemical cross-linking treatment of the microcapsule, and achieving the microcapsule. The prepared antibacterial Chinese mugwort oil microcapsules have the basically same antibacterial performance as Chinese mugwort oil. On the same condition, the Chinese mugwort oil hardly has antibacterial performance after placed for 30 days. The prepared Chinese mugwort oil microcapsules still have strong antibacterial performance after placed for 40 days, thereby achieving the purpose of sustained release and enabling application prospect to be wide.

Description

Technical field [0001] The invention relates to a method for preparing microcapsules, in particular to a method for preparing antibacterial microcapsules of mugwort oil / gelatin and acacia gum. technical background [0002] Mugwort is a perennial wild herb belonging to the genus Artemisia of the Compositae family. The essential oil of Mugwort extracted from it has a wide variety of physiologically active ingredients. Many of the monoterpenoids and sesquiterpene chemicals have antibacterial activities. The antibacterial and antifungal agent is in line with people's green consumption concept. However, due to the instability of mugwort essential oil, its efficacy lasts for a short time, which limits its application. The microcapsule technology can improve the pressure sensitivity, photosensitivity and heat sensitivity of mugwort essential oil by encapsulating the essential oils and slowly release them through the capsule wall, and improve the product grade and added value.
